Purpose And Scope
As a member of the Digital Partnerships team, this role will be responsible for the negotiation, execution, management, and compliance of contracts related to IT services. This role will be responsible for ensuring that all contracts align with organizational goals and legal requirements while fostering strong relationships with internal stakeholders and external service providers.
Responsibilities And Accountabilities
- Contract Negotiation: Lead the negotiation of contracts for IT services, ensuring favorable terms and conditions that align with Astellas' objectives. Partner with IS Business Stakeholders, Vendors, Legal, Procurement, and Compliance teams to reach consensus on contract terms, ensuring alignment with company policies and regulatory requirements.
- Contract Management: Oversee the entire contract lifecycle, from drafting and execution to renewal and termination, using enterprise tools such as ServiceNow, Ariba, and Aravo.
- Requirements Gathering: Work with DigitalX stakeholders to ensure requirements are adequately documented and shared with vendors.
- Vendor Relationship Management: Build and maintain strong relationships with vendors and service providers, addressing any issues or concerns that may arise.
- Escalations: Escalate issues and/or questions to more senior member of contracting team.
- Risk Assessment: Identify and assess risks associated with contracts and develop strategies to mitigate them.
- Collaboration: Work closely with cross-functional teams, including DigitalX, Procurement, and Legal, to ensure alignment on contract scope, terms, and service delivery.
- Performance Monitoring: Monitor vendor performance against contract terms and service level agreements (SLAs), ensuring compliance and addressing any discrepancies.
- Documentation and Reporting: Maintain accurate records of contracts and related documentation and provide regular reports to management on contract status and performance. Monitor contract timelines for renewals, amendments, and terminations.
- Procure-to-Pay Support: Support Procure-to-Pay processes, including Purchase Order creation/changes and resolution of accounting issues (e.g., funding limits, incorrect coding, etc.)
